随着技术的不断进步,人脸识别技术被广泛应用于各个领域。其中,人脸识别验证码系统作为一种安全性较高的验证手段受到了广泛关注和使用。然而,有时候该系统可能会出现不可用的情况,造成用户无法正常进行验证。本文将针对人脸识别验证码系统不可用问题展开详细的排查与解决。
问题排查
1. 硬件故障:
- 检查摄像头是否连接正常,可能需要重新插拔或更换摄像头。
- 检查网络连接是否正常,确保图像传输没有出现问题。
2. 软件配置问题:
- 检查人脸识别算法是否正确部署。可能需要重新安装或更新算法库。
- 检查系统配置文件是否正确,确保系统能够调用正确的接口和参数。
3. 数据库异常:
- 检查人脸数据库是否正常,可能需要重新建立或修复数据库。
- 检查数据库连接是否正确,确保系统能够正常读取人脸数据。
4. 环境因素:
- 检查光线是否足够明亮,如果环境过暗可能会导致人脸识别失败。
- 检查环境噪声是否过大,如有过大噪声可能会影响人脸特征提取。
解决方案
1. 确保硬件设备正常工作:
- 检查摄像头线缆是否松动或损坏,重新插拔或更换线缆。
- 检查网络连接是否正常,可能需要联系网络管理员进行排查和修复。
2. 配置正确的软件环境:
- 确认人脸识别算法的正确部署,按照算法库提供的说明进行安装和配置。
- 检查系统配置文件的正确性,确保参数和接口调用都是正确的。
3. 检查数据库状态和连接:
- 检查数据库是否正常运行,如有异常可能需要重启或修复数据库。
- 检查数据库连接参数是否正确,确保系统能够正常读写数据库。
4. 优化环境条件:
- 提供充足的光线,如果环境太暗,可以增加灯光或移动至较亮的环境进行验证。
- 减少环境噪声,如人声等干扰,可以在静音环境下进行验证。
人脸识别验证码系统不可用问题可能由多种原因引起,包括硬件故障、软件配置问题、数据库异常和环境因素等。通过仔细排查和解决上述问题,可以有效地解决人脸识别验证码系统不可用的情况,保证系统的正常运行。同时,开发人员在系统设计和部署过程中也应该考虑到这些潜在问题,并采取相应的措施来预防和处理。